The AI in space exploration market size has grown exponentially in recent years. It will grow from $4.44 billion in 2024 to $5.8 billion in 2025 at a compound annual growth rate (CAGR) of 30.5%. The growth in the historic period can be attributed to demand for AI technology to enhance space missions, increased government investment, increased autonomous systems and robotics, increased data management, cognitive cloud computing in space.

The AI in space exploration market size is expected to see exponential growth in the next few years. It will grow to $16.69 billion in 2029 at a compound annual growth rate (CAGR) of 30.2%. The growth in the forecast period can be attributed to increasing number of space launches, increasing number of space missions, increasing autonomous vehicles, increasing anomaly detection, increasing satellite operations. Major trends in the forecast period include technological advancements, product innovations, integrating AI technologies, Ai-powered robots, development of new space technologies.

The growth of the AI in space exploration market is expected to be driven by an increasing number of space missions in the future. Space missions involve organized endeavors to explore outer space or celestial bodies using various technologies such as spacecraft, satellites, rovers, telescopes, and more. AI plays a crucial role in space exploration by enhancing capabilities across various aspects including autonomous navigation and control, advanced data analysis, automated planning and scheduling, and advanced robotics. For example, the United Nations Office for Outer Space Affairs reported an increase in the launch of space missions, with 2,664 objects launched into orbit in 2023 compared to 2,478 in 2022, indicating a rise in space exploration activities.

Leading companies in the AI in space exploration market are focusing on developing strategic collaborations to bolster their market position. Strategic collaborations involve purposeful partnerships or alliances between entities to achieve common goals, leveraging complementary strengths and resources for mutual benefit. For instance, in February 2023, IBM and NASA collaborated to apply artificial intelligence to Earth science data, aiming to uncover new insights about our planet. This collaboration entails the development of AI foundation models to analyze vast amounts of text and remote-sensing data, with the models being open and available to the entire science community.

In August 2023, Sidus Space, a US-based satellite manufacturing and space services company, acquired Exo-Space, a US-based company specializing in hardware and software for Edge Artificial Intelligence applications in space, for an undisclosed amount. Through this acquisition, Sidus aims to expand its talent, technology, and total addressable market by integrating Exo-Space's stand-alone AI and machine learning products into its business lines.

AI in space exploration involves the utilization of artificial intelligence (AI) and machine learning (ML) technologies to analyze data, automate spacecraft operations, and enhance decision-making across various facets of space exploration. It has become an indispensable tool in this field, aiding scientists and engineers in making discoveries and deepening their understanding of the universe.

The primary types of AI in space exploration include rovers, robotic arms, space probes, and other related technologies. Rovers are robotic vehicles specifically designed for exploration and research, particularly in environments where human presence may be challenging or impractical. Various applications encompass robotics, remote sensing and monitoring, data analytics, asteroid mining, manned vehicles and reusable launch systems, communications, and remote missions, catering to various end-users such as government entities and commercial enterprises.
